We have had this epoxy resin filled ‘radioactive’ container toy on the market for 3 years. Recently a change was made to the resin coloring process resulting in the use of more than one brand of alcohol based hobby store dyes to be mixed together. This change was made as we were having difficulty getting the ‘hot pink’ color using the original Tim Holtz ink
Unfortunately, we have 2 customers who have reported the color completely faded back to the original clear resin vs 60 who have purchased during this timeframe. We suspect this change as the cause of this issue as we have 500+ customers with no issues.
Does anyone have any ideas how to achieve a consistently hot pink clear resin. We are running experiments to recreate fading with a light exposure but want to work on finding a good, consistent ink.
Original ink is Tim Holtz Alcohol Ink in Wild Plum
Secondary ink is Brea Reese -

Hi Kristin,
Unfortunately, I’ve had this experience too when using pink and purple alcohol inks in resin. If they aren’t designed for resin, they won’t stay that color.
